    Range report Sig SRD762Ti

    I bought this can spur of the moment the last day before the new law took effect. I was told this can was very quiet. It's a direct thread can, my first and it screwed on very firm and felt solid and lined up perfect. It's a titanium can so the weight is reasonable, but it's a pretty beefy can. It measures 9.3, the same size as my Sig 338LM can.

    I shot it side by side :
    my AAC 7.62SDN on 24 inch 308
    The Sig on Marks 20 inch Rem 700

    It was markedly more quiet. And I think it should based on the size. Happy with the can.

    I'm pretty happy with most all cans, not terrible picky. I just need the can to line up straight and make my gun hush hush.

    The can has no less than 17 baffles. Pappabear and I both observed (in real time) that smoke poof that you sometimes see in still photos of suppressors being fired. This can really slows down the gas release.
